John Lee Hooker featuring Carlos Santana from 1989’s The Healer, an outstanding album that pairs John Lee Hooker with a collection of artists including Bonnie Raitt, Robert Cray, Los Lobos, George Thorogood and others.

“The Healer” is the standout track for me though:
